HB 6345 Summary

  • Amends the Local Development Financing Act (1986 PA 281) to expand certified technology park designations by allowing 2 additional parks to be designated between June 1, 2010 and April 1, 2011.

  • Establishes provisions for certified alternative energy parks, defining alternative energy technology businesses and eligible property including research, development, and manufacturing of alternative energy systems.

  • Authorizes municipalities to apply to the Michigan Economic Development Corporation for designation of authority districts as certified technology parks or certified alternative energy parks under written agreements.

  • Permits authority and municipality participation in certified technology parks with specific evaluation criteria including institutional support, business incubators, business plans, and infrastructure development requirements.

  • Requires state reimbursement to intermediate and local school districts for tax revenue lost through tax increment capture in newly designated certified technology parks, with foundation allowances protected from reduction.
